Corgi Toys 202 Morris Cowley
Morris Cowley Saloon by Corgi Toys, No. 202. Near mint plus/boxed. Very pale green & blue. Scarce model from The Pennsylvanian Collection.
Notes
This early Corgi car has a shining all original paint finish in palest green with a blue roof, flat spun wheels. Shiny base and well-shaped original tyres. Issued between 1956-61.
In close to mint condition.
Little chip on a wheel arch and a mere mark or two besides. The base has a circular dab of cream paint. Over the years, we have seen this applied to some models – it leads us to surmise that this was done to identify it as a sales rep. sample, or similar.
Glossy finish. Very bright and shiny smooth hubs. Well-shaped tyres.
The blue and yellow picture box is complete, if rather grubby now. Crisp feel. No tears. Plenty of end flap spring.
